Experience the freedom of the open road in Portugal as you embark on an unforgettable 5-day road trip! This experience caters to every traveler, featuring destinations like Porto, Vila Nova De Gaia, Peso Da Regua, Amarante, Gerês, Ponte da Barca, Campo do Gerês, Tenões, Braga, and Guimaraes.

This perfectly planned road trip itinerary in Portugal takes you through some of the best places to see in the country. You will spend 2 nights in Porto, 1 night in Peso Da Regua, and 1 night in Campo do Gerês. Experience an unparalleled adventure on day 2 of your road trip in Portugal. This exciting part of your journey invites you to discover the renowned landmarks in 3 vibrant destinations - Porto, Vila Nova De Gaia, and Peso Da Regua. After a day filled with exploration and new experiences, you will retreat to the hotel of your choice in Peso Da Regua. You will spend 1 night here for some well-deserved relaxation.

Get ready for an exciting day in Porto. Today’s sightseeing agenda includes a monument, a church, a park, a museum and much more! Begin your adventure at Clerigos Tower. This is a captivating monument you should not miss. Another must-see is Porto Cathedral, a locally renowned church in Porto.

When you’re ready for the next sight, head to Luís I Bridge. From there, take a leisurely stroll to Jardim Do Morro, another of the city’s notable attractions. We recommend continuing your self-guided tour at Douro Museum, a history-steeped place of interest in the city.
